The **Senior Global Deal Strategy Analyst** is a critical member of the Commercial team and serves as a trusted advisor to the Sales team on deal structures, advises the team on alternative terms and contract options, and or value propositioning to help drive deal closure. This role will provide analysis and support to the sales team in the form of pricing, discounts, contract terms, and product availability. Additionally, this role works with the sales team to ensure that all opportunities are maximized and that a convincing proposition is presented to the customer. In addition, they work with other departments within the company to ensure that all deals are structured correctly and that all approvals are in place. Focuses on minimizing sales cycle times while optimizing revenue, profitability, and/or market share based on business priorities.
